Output 3dd893af07a168f2a8b34829e38be045f0d2aabe5e3f74938963f3b75f967329:16

value
202968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2c4f9353b824526251063c59ba8070591079018 OP_EQUAL
address
3LuTnnTsEzwkzs2ZnwRr8q1ifw5bfbYoeN
transaction
3dd893af07a168f2a8b34829e38be045f0d2aabe5e3f74938963f3b75f967329
spent
true